Red = usually ATF.
Drivers-side is where the transmission sits.

Clean the entire area THOROUGHLY with more brakleen so there's no more mystery oil/leaks. Start the engine then start snooping around. I bet you'll find something suspicious eventually.

Yuppers, except mine looked worse. There was a mound of corrosion on the lines that run under the radiator to the trans. I couldn't get those lines anywhere, hence a couple of pieces of hose. Major clean up, too. Fun times. Not at all difficult, just messy.
